Yes but it may be better to change your separator. I haven't tested this but it should work...
$.tablesorter.addParser({ id: "dotDate", is: function(s) { return /\d{1,2}\.\d{1,2}\.\d{2,4}/.test(s); }, format: function(s,table) { s = s.replace(/(\d{1,2})\.(\d{1,2})\.(\d{2,4})/, "$1/$2/$3"); return $.tablesorter.formatFloat(new Date(s).getTime()); }, type: "numeric" }); stephen On Wed, Nov 5, 2008 at 11:53, Josip Lazic <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> > Is it possible to sort column with dates in dd.mm.yyyy format? > >
